site stats

Sas input infile

Webb27 dec. 2016 · You do get INVALID DATA messages. SAS is defaulting to space delimited fields, you need to specify the DSD INFILE statement option and or DLM=','. You don't actually need MISSOVER as you have the proper number of delimiters for three comma delimited fields, but I would probably go ahead and keep it. Webb27 nov. 2024 · I am trying to input it in my SAS program, so that it would look something like that: Mark Country Type Count Price 1 Mark1 Country1 type1 1 1.50 2 Mark1 Country1 type2 5 21.00 3 Mark1 Country1 type3 NA NA 4 Mark2 Country2 type1 2 197.50 5 Mark2 Country2 type2 2 201.00 6 Mark2 Country2 type3 1 312.50

SAS Help Center: Reading Raw Data with the INPUT …

Webb13 jan. 2024 · For information about the DATA step, see Base SAS Utilities: Reference. INFILE Statement Overview of the INFILE Statement. In a SAS DATA step, the INFILE … Webb17 feb. 2001 · - SAS Editor window에서 자료를 직접 입력할 때 필요한 명령 5. RUN - SAS에서 DATA step이나 PROC step이 끝나는 부분에 하나의 step이 완성되었음을 알리는 문장 - 모든 SAS step은 RUN 으로 끝나야 완성된 SAS step 6. PUT: 출력되는 자료들을 지정된 외부 file에 출력하는 기능 towns in jefferson county colorado https://marbob.net

Reading All variables through INPUT statement - SAS

Webb5 apr. 2024 · Input values must be separated by at least one blank (the default delimiter) or by the delimiter specified with the DLM= or DLMSTR= option in the INFILE statement. If … Webb14 feb. 2024 · Normally, each INPUT statement in a DATA step reads a new data record into the input buffer. When you use a trailing @, the following occurs: The pointer position does not change. No new record is read into the input buffer. The next INPUT statement for the same iteration of the DATA step continues to read the same record rather than a new … WebbAn Introduction to SAS Viya Programming for SAS 9 Programmers. Getting Started. Data Migration. Accessing Data. DATA Step Programming. Working with User-Defined Formats. Preparing and Analyzing Data. Graphing Your CAS Output. CAS Action Programming with CASL, Lua, and Python. towns in jefferson county

infile- problem with blanks - SAS Support Communities

Category:SAS Help Center

Tags:Sas input infile

Sas input infile

SAS Help Center

Webb10 mars 2015 · One of the nice things about proc import is that it outputs data step code with infile and input statements to the log. For datasets with a lot of variables, I often … Webb26 dec. 2024 · In SAS, you can create a new dataset by reading data from an input file (Excel, CSV, TXT, etc.), by using an existing dataset, or by entering the data manually. The last one is known as instream data and is a convenient way to quickly create a dataset with a small amount of data. A SAS program to enter data manually consists of at least 3 ...

Sas input infile

Did you know?

Webb3 juli 2024 · These are the steps to import an Excel File in SAS: 1. Define the location, file name, and file extension. The first argument of the PROC IMPORT procedure is the FILE=-argument. This argument specifies the location, file name, and file extension of the Excel file. This information must be enclosed in double-quotes. Webb20 feb. 2014 · Yes the temporary buffer as each line is read contains the variables up to the second one you want (the input statement shouldn't include any variables past the ones you want to reduce the size of the input buffer), but that is ONE record in memory at a time not written to the disk.

Webb4.在拓展上,SAS中还有很多读取数据的语句,例如input语句、import语句等,这些语句在不同的场景下可以更加灵活地读取数据。. sas中infile语句用法. 1ቤተ መጻሕፍቲ ባይዱ infile语句是SAS中用来读取数据文件(如txt、csv等)的语句。. 2.在infile语句中,需要指定要 ... Webb11 aug. 2024 · The INPUT statement describes the arrangement of values in an input record. The INPUT statement reads records from a file specified in the previously executed INFILE statement, reading the values into SAS/IML variables. There are two ways to describe a record’s values in a SAS/IML INPUT statement: list (or scanning) input …

Webb7 apr. 2024 · INFILE statement - used in specifying the location of the data file. DSD - To change the select demarcator from an blank in a point. FIRSTOBS=2: This tells SAS that the second dispute containing data values press the first row features variable names. Example. data outdata; infile 'C:\Users\Simplilearn\documents\book1.csv' dsd firstobs=2; Webbinfileステートメントは実行ステートメントであるため、if-thenステートメントのような条件付き処理でinfileステートメントを使用できます。infileステートメントを使用すると …

WebbThe following SAS statements also read data or point to a location where data are stored: The INFILE statement points to raw data lines stored in another file. The INPUT …

Webbwant? A SAS data step and the INPUT statement. There are three things we need to read raw data in a data step: A data source (INFILE) An INPUT statement A list of fields to … towns in jefferson county ilWebb1 juni 2024 · Hi, I'm trying to infile rpt. file and i have problems with values that have blanks. Sas is giving me records from next column but I want him to show me the blank. the file looks like this 5------10---- ab cd 1 null null null null 4 no i want to infile it ... towns in jefferson county paWebb13 apr. 2024 · Which SAS program correctly produces the desired output? A. data WORK.NUMBERS; length Name $ 4 Month $ 3 Status $ 7; infile 'TEXTFILE.TXT' dsd; input Name $ Month $; if Month='FEB' then input Week1 Week2 Week3 Week4 Status $; else if Month='MAR' then input Week1 Week2 Week3 Week4 Week5 Status $; format Week1 … towns in jefferson county kentucky